Buying Guide

Choosing the right putter can make a big difference in your game. Here are some key factors to consider:

Putter Type

  • Blade: Traditional and offers great control.
  • Mallet: Heavier and provides stability on impact.

Length

The putter should be the right length for your height. I suggest trying different lengths. A good fit helps with stance and control.

Weight

Weight affects how the putter feels during swings. Light putters are easier to control, while heavier ones can aid distance. Choose what feels best for you.

Grip

The grip is important for comfort. I like to choose a grip that feels good in my hands. Consider thickness and texture based on your grip style.

Face Design

Different face designs can affect how the ball rolls. Some faces provide a softer touch, while others are firmer. Try a few to see which you prefer.

Price

Set a budget before shopping. There are quality putters in various price ranges. Knowing your price limit can help narrow down options.

Testing

I recommend testing different putters before buying. Visit a local shop or a range that allows you to try them out. Getting a feel for each putter is key.
